How Belts and Hoses Function

Serpentine belts transfer power from the engine crankshaft to components such as alternators, compressors, and power steering systems. Timing belts (on equipped engines) ensure precise synchronization between engine internals. Radiator and heater hoses transport coolant between the engine, radiator, and heating system to regulate temperature. These systems work alongside the engine to support performance and efficiency.

Why Belts and Hoses Wear Out

Heat cycling causes rubber materials to dry out, crack, and lose elasticity over time. Exposure to oil or coolant can weaken structural integrity and cause swelling. Continuous engine tension gradually stretches belts and reduces efficiency. Internal hose layers may deteriorate due to long-term pressure and temperature fluctuations.

Signs of Belt or Hose Failure

Squealing or chirping noises during startup or acceleration often indicate worn belts. Cracks, glazing, or fraying suggest belts are nearing failure.
